日本综合一区二区|亚洲中文天堂综合|日韩欧美自拍一区|男女精品天堂一区|欧美自拍第6页亚洲成人精品一区|亚洲黄色天堂一区二区成人|超碰91偷拍第一页|日韩av夜夜嗨中文字幕|久久蜜综合视频官网|精美人妻一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問(wèn)題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營(yíng)銷解決方案
unty游戲開(kāi)發(fā)都需要學(xué)什么技術(shù)

Unity游戲開(kāi)發(fā)基礎(chǔ)學(xué)習(xí)

在開(kāi)始制作游戲之前,首先需要掌握的是Unity游戲開(kāi)發(fā)的基礎(chǔ)知識(shí),這包括對(duì)Unity編輯器的熟悉,理解游戲?qū)ο?GameObject)和組件(Component)的概念,以及如何使用場(chǎng)景(Scene)和游戲管理器(GameManager)來(lái)組織游戲流程,還需要了解如何導(dǎo)入和使用資源,例如3D模型、紋理、音頻和視頻等。

編程語(yǔ)言學(xué)習(xí)

Unity支持多種編程語(yǔ)言,但C#是最常用的一種,學(xué)習(xí)C#對(duì)于Unity游戲開(kāi)發(fā)來(lái)說(shuō)至關(guān)重要,你需要了解C#的基本語(yǔ)法和結(jié)構(gòu),包括變量、數(shù)據(jù)類型、控制語(yǔ)句、循環(huán)、數(shù)組、集合、類和對(duì)象等,你還需要學(xué)習(xí)如何在Unity中使用C#來(lái)創(chuàng)建腳本,控制游戲?qū)ο蟮男袨?,以及?shí)現(xiàn)游戲邏輯。

圖形編程學(xué)習(xí)

如果你希望你的游戲看起來(lái)更美觀,那么你需要學(xué)習(xí)一些圖形編程的知識(shí),這包括了解渲染管線(Rendering Pipeline)的工作原理,理解材質(zhì)(Material)和著色器(Shader)的概念,以及如何使用它們來(lái)改變物體的外觀,你還需要學(xué)習(xí)光照(Lighting)和陰影(Shadow)的使用,以及如何通過(guò)后期處理(PostProcessing)來(lái)增強(qiáng)游戲的視覺(jué)效果。

物理和動(dòng)畫(huà)學(xué)習(xí)

為了讓游戲更加真實(shí),你需要學(xué)習(xí)如何在Unity中實(shí)現(xiàn)物理效果和動(dòng)畫(huà),這包括理解剛體(Rigidbody)和碰撞器(Collider)的使用,以及如何通過(guò)力(Force)和扭矩(Torque)來(lái)影響物體的運(yùn)動(dòng),你還需要學(xué)習(xí)如何創(chuàng)建和使用動(dòng)畫(huà),包括關(guān)鍵幀動(dòng)畫(huà)(Keyframe Animation)和骨骼動(dòng)畫(huà)(Skeletal Animation)。

用戶界面和輸入學(xué)習(xí)

為了讓玩家能夠與游戲進(jìn)行交互,你需要學(xué)習(xí)如何在Unity中創(chuàng)建用戶界面(UI)和處理輸入,這包括了解如何使用Canvas和UI組件來(lái)創(chuàng)建界面,如何布局和樣式化界面元素,以及如何通過(guò)事件系統(tǒng)(Event System)來(lái)響應(yīng)玩家的操作,你還需要學(xué)習(xí)如何處理不同的輸入設(shè)備,例如鍵盤(pán)、鼠標(biāo)、觸摸屏和游戲手柄。

網(wǎng)絡(luò)編程學(xué)習(xí)

如果你想制作多人在線游戲,那么你需要學(xué)習(xí)一些網(wǎng)絡(luò)編程的知識(shí),這包括了解客戶端服務(wù)器模型,理解TCP和UDP協(xié)議,以及如何使用Unity的網(wǎng)絡(luò)庫(kù)來(lái)實(shí)現(xiàn)多人游戲的功能。

優(yōu)化和調(diào)試學(xué)習(xí)

你需要學(xué)習(xí)如何優(yōu)化和調(diào)試你的游戲,這包括了解性能分析工具的使用,如何找出和修復(fù)游戲中的錯(cuò)誤,以及如何通過(guò)調(diào)整設(shè)置來(lái)提高游戲的性能。

相關(guān)問(wèn)答FAQs

Q1: Unity支持哪些編程語(yǔ)言?

A1: Unity支持C#、JavaScript(UnityScript)和Boo三種編程語(yǔ)言,但C#是最常用的一種。

Q2: 什么是Unity中的游戲?qū)ο蠛徒M件?

A2: 在Unity中,游戲?qū)ο?GameObject)是所有交互式對(duì)象的基類,它可以包含多個(gè)組件(Component),組件是一個(gè)封裝了特定功能的模塊,例如物理效果、音效、AI等,游戲?qū)ο蠛徒M件的關(guān)系類似于面向?qū)ο缶幊讨械膶?duì)象和類的關(guān)系。


新聞標(biāo)題:unty游戲開(kāi)發(fā)都需要學(xué)什么技術(shù)
網(wǎng)址分享:http://www.dlmjj.cn/article/djeopdj.html